A total of 11 area players were selected to the Missouri High School Volleyball Coaches Association all-state team earlier this month. The Jefferson City Lady Jays and the Blair Oaks Lady Falcons each had three all-state honorees. Helias, California, Eldon, Southern Boone and Versailles each had one player named to the all-state team.
It was a long, draining, grueling day of volleyball for the Jefferson City Lady Jays. What mattered most was it ended with everyone smiling. Jefferson City tied its best state finish in program history Thursday, defeating the St. Michael the Archangel Guardians 23-25, 25-18, 25-18, 25-19 in the Class 4 third-place match at the Show Me Center.

After the Jefferson City Lady Jays had their season end on their home floor in each of the past two seasons, there was no way they were letting it happen again. Jefferson City was able to accomplish that goal Saturday against the Webb City Lady Cardinals, as they battled back from two separate one-set deficits to force a fifth set and pick up a 19-25, 27-25, 21-25, 25-23, 15-13 victory in the Class 4 quarterfinals at Fleming Fieldhouse.
